    Charged with battery. What will be the outcome?
    What happens if I'm charged with assault by beating (battery) , assaulted someone by beating them. But no mention of any beating in any statement. What's the outcome going to be even if I admitted getting some water in her hair?

    You don't have to beat someone to commit battery. Throwing water on her would probably be sufficient.

    U assume you are in the UK.
    "...
    Battery involves unlawfully touching another person (this does not include everyday knocks and jolts to which people silently consent as the result of crowds). No physical injury is necessary. Battery is distinguished from the offence of common assault, where the victim is caused to apprehend the immediate commission of a battery.

    The terms "battery" and "beat" are not normally used (if at all) in statutory provisions creating offences of aggravated assault ..."
